一、 循环播放常见适用的mp3、wma后缀格式歌曲音乐代码 <bgsound loop="infinite" src="音乐地址"/></bgsound> (店铺音乐代码) (注:以上音乐代码针对常见适用的“mp3和wma” 后缀格式,为确保上述“音乐代码”的正确性,在使用过程中,如果最终出现属于代码方面的正确性问题,请自行详细对照下列钳入图片中不可更改之相同的“音乐代码”进行认真复核) 二、 首先向大家提供一个搜索网络歌曲使用的网址 http://www.baidu.com (A)将“音乐代码”转换为“歌曲代码” 字串8 (B)将“店铺音乐代码”转换为“歌曲代码” (C)论坛背景“音乐代码”使用前说明 (D)论坛背景“歌曲代码”3步操作程序 (E)艺术之窗 三 、背景音乐相关常见问题 (1)使用音乐代码需要特别仔细细心,如果存在一个小小的动作处理不到位,则“背景音乐”往往不会成功播放(比如:空格处理问题就非常非常突出); (2)能够在线播放试听的歌曲却不一定能转载的过来...这是因为歌曲的知识产权和商业因素的关联,而在网络歌曲的源头就被设定了屏蔽转载...这是正常现象; (3)自己拥有和设定程序后的网络歌曲一般不会被屏蔽:歌曲定格(或变通转格定位)--->上传--->试听播放--->转载 (备注:其操作原理和网络电子相册图片操作及设定雷同) (4)论坛主帖第一页之后插入歌曲代码,如果出现本来不是被屏蔽的歌曲而出现了屏蔽歌曲的现象,可用“引用”功能一次加以解决(注:如果源头网络更新屏蔽歌曲...则所有转载歌曲随之屏蔽) (5)取消“背景音乐”播放按Esc键 加背景音乐,其实就是贴段儿代码。
咱们从最简单的开始。最简洁的代码是这样的: <bgsound src="你的背景音乐地址" loop=-1> 或者: <embed loop="-1" controls="ControlPanel" width="0" height="0" src="你的背景音乐地址"> 两者的最大区别在于前者页面被最小化之后音乐就停了;后者页面最小化后音乐还是照旧播放,直到窗口被关闭。 共同点是,页面是当前窗口的时候,按ESC键,音乐都会停。 以上两段代码都是放在<head>之间的 再来,稍微复杂一些的:有淘友问,能不能让背景音乐每次刷新都变不同的曲目,这个也不难。 把如下代码加入<body>区域中,页面打开时就会有随机播放背景音乐 <SCRIPT language="java - script"> <!-- var sound1="song1.mid" var sound2="song2.mid" var sound3="song3.mid" var sound4="song4.mid" var sound5="song5.mid" var sound6="song6.mid" var sound7="song7.mid" var sound8="song8.mid" var sound9="song9.mid" var sound10="song10.mid" var x=Math.round(Math.random()*9) if (x==0) x=sound1 else if (x==1) x=sound2 else if (x==2) x=sound3 else if (x==3) x=sound4 else if (x==4) x=sound5 else if (x==5) x=sound6 else if (x==6) x=sound7 else if (x==7) x=sound8 else if (x==8 ) x=sound9 else x=sound10 if (navigator.appName=="Microsoft Internet Explorer" ) document.write('<bgsound src='+'"'+x+'"'+' loop="infinite">') else document.write('<embed src='+'"'+x+'"'+'hidden="true" border="0" width="20" height="20" loop="true">') //--> </SCRIPT> 把你找来的音乐分别替换上面“songN.mid”部分,然后把这短代码贴在<head>之间就好了。 有一点很要紧:背景音乐越大,所在页面的载入速度就越慢。所以您找来的音乐最好体积小一些。一般来说,midi比较好。 需要说明的一点是:目前装修咱们的店铺公告板的时候,只能用<bgsound>这段代码(最简单的)。上面列出的另外两种代码,由于考虑到安全策略问题,故目前在淘宝网上暂时还不能用。但是你可以用到你的个人主页等其他地方啊。*^_^* |
|